Key Differences

In short — Core i3-3220 outperforms Celeron B815 on the selected game parameters. We do not have the prices of both CPUs to compare value. The better performing Core i3-3220 is 246 days newer than Celeron B815.

Advantages of Intel Celeron B815

  • Consumes up to 36% less energy than Intel Core i3-3220 - 35 vs 55 Watts

Advantages of Intel Core i3-3220

  • Performs up to 2% better in God of War than Celeron B815 - 163 vs 160 FPS
  • Can execute more multi-threaded tasks simultaneously than Intel Celeron B815 - 4 vs 2 threads
